Next to a hardware firewall, ZoneAlarm is about as good as it gets, and its free. :-) You will be surprised to see all the traffic that's knocking on your computer's door? ZoneAlarm will stop a lot of it. And even better, if someone gets in, ZoneAlarm won't let them get back out. It's pretty darn embarassing to discover your computer is being used by someone else as the source of their doings.
